Dealing with Alcohol Addiction

The best way to deal with alcoholism is recognizing the actual problem.

A lot of people believe that they can kick the problem on their own, but that doesn't work for most people. Find someone you trust to talk to. It may help to talk to a friend or someone your own age at first, but a supportive and understanding adult is your best option for getting help. If you can't talk to your parents, you might want to approach a school counsellor, relative, doctor, favourite teacher, or religious leader.

However, overcoming addiction is not easy. Quitting drugs or drinking is probably going to be one of the hardest things you've ever done. It's not a sign of weakness if you need professional help from a trained drug counsellor or therapist. Most people who try to kick a drug or alcohol problem need professional assistance or a treatment program to do so.



Alcoholism

Alcoholism is a problem raised by consuming alcohol in excess to the extent that the overall behavior of an addict effected greatly. It also interferes with the alcoholic's normal personal, family, social, or work life. The chronic consequences of excess alcohol consumption will further lead to psychological and physiological disorders.

The primary negative impact of alcoholism is to encourage the sufferer to drink at times and in amounts that are damaging. The secondary damage caused by an inability to control one's drinking manifests in many ways.

Most victims do not realize the fact that taking alcohol in excess is affecting their overall health and the health effects start to manifest. The physical health effects associated with alcohol consumption include cirrhosis of the liver, pancreatitis, polyneuropathy, alcoholic dementia, heart disease, increased chance of cancer, nutritional deficiencies, sexual dysfunction, and death from many sources.

Link between Addiction And Depression

Addiction and depression are co-related. Many people take up drinking or drugs just to escape from depression. Before we understand the relation between the two, it is better to understand the concepts of two in brief;

Depression is a state of the mind when a person gets terrible feelings. In this condition, usually patients feel very negative also known as blues for more than at least two weeks. Depression can happen due to a number of reasons such as anxiety, excess thinking, trauma and such others. A depressed person may not get interest in any activity. Sometimes, patients may not be able to come out of the bed due to excess depression.

Signs of Depression:
Extreme mood swings. Some days feeling too low and some days feeling too high or happy
No interest in activities that they used to like earlier
Gaining or losing a noticeable amount of weight
Felling too tired to do your casual works
Guilt or worthless feeling
Trouble in concentrating or focusing on anything
Thoughts of suicides and death

Depression is a bad situation that develops the feelings of weakness in a person. Hence, many people move towards taking drugs or alcohol to retain their composure or mood. According to them, taking alcohol in excess is the easiest way to run away from dreadful feelings.

Effects of alcoholism

It is no secret that excessive use of alcohol is bad for the health. Alcohol abuse causes harm to the brain and central nervous system.

Other effects of alcoholism include:

• Fatigue
• Short term memory loss
• Weakness and paralysis of eye muscles
• Liver disorder
• Gastrointestinal problems
• Cardiovascular problems
• Causes erectile dysfunction in men and interrupt menstruation in women
• Increased risk of cancer
• Weakened immune system
• Clumsiness
• Financial problems
• Relationship problems
• Emotional and other health related difficulties

Alcoholism Treatment

For any treatment it is necessary for one to admit and accept the problem. This is the first important step that helps in breaking addiction. The second step is to take the help of a professional health care professional. They will do check up and see which stage of alcoholism you are in. Accordingly, they will counsel you and provide you with the in house treatment program. Not everyone requires undergoing residential treatment. If it’s the first stage of alcoholism and mild one, then by counselling only the problem can be solved. Her family and friends provide great support.

But if its in third or forth stage, then enrolling for residential program is a must. A good rehabilitation centre will provide you with the tips and personalized care. This will help you to overcome problem successfully and avoid the chances of alcoholism relapse in future.
